Auditions set for 2021 Snowbird Theater production Feb. 27

Auditions set for 2021 Snowbird Theater production Feb. 27

By Judi Pugh
The Snowbird Season Theater Goup is looking for snowbird and local actors and actresses for the 2021 play A Bad Year for Tomatoes. Auditions are being held on Thursday, February 27 at 10:00 a.m. at the South Baldwin Community Theater at 2022 West 2nd Street in Gulf Shores. The play requires a strong female lead and includes 3 female and 4 male parts. Actors and actresses must be in the Gulf Shores area for all of January and February 2021 for rehearsals and performances. Typical rehearsal schedule could be Monday through Friday for 2-3 hours with longer commitments the last two weeks before the play opens in February. The play will run Wednesday through Sunday for two weeks. For a copy of the script or more information, contact Larry Rebert at 269-330-4214 or larryrebert@yahoo.com.
